THE National Action for Quality Education in Zambia is calling for an urgent indaba in Western Province to address the poor performance in national examinations at Grade 9 and Grade 12 levels. Western Province recorded the lowest Grade 12 pass rate in 2024 at 44.17 percent, while Eastern Province recorded the highest at 82.19 percent. In a statement, Wednesday, NAQEZ Deputy Provincial Coordinator for Western Province Simui Namunji proposed that MPs from the province, traditional leaders, teachers’ unions, clergy and faith-based organisations, parents’ representatives, among others, should be invited to the roundtable meeting to address the matter. “The National Action for Quality Education in Zambia (NAQEZ), Western Province, is calling for an urgent Provincial Indaba to address the alarming poor...
